The Story
I started creating jewellery over two years ago after having the same dream for over a week. I kept seeing a static image of a bracelet in my dreams every single night, so in the end I asked a friend of mine to take me to a bead shop in Beak Street, London. From that moment I was hooked.I am mainly self-taught, I attended a couple of evening classes in silversmithing and working with bio-resin. I like to learn a technique, and then move on onto another one...
In currently create one-of-a-kind costume jewellery pieces, I also enjoy working with resin, polymer clay, metal clays - to name just a few. I sell my jewellery directly to public, as well as via some of the finest boutiques in the U.K. I also run jewellery making workshops at Mary's Living and Giving shop in Notting Hill.
